Siemens Gamesa and Laulagun implemented a double axis approach that combined experiments at test bench level, intended to mimic real failure development and symptoms, with other developments directly based on the analysis of data from in-service wind turbine. Physical models were implemented by both companies to assess mechanical diagnostic and prognostic capacities associated to the pitch system/blade bearing. The ROMEO project has introduced the following innovations in blade bearings of Laulagun:
– Full integration of smart temperature, strain gauge and displacement sensors in blade bearings
– Advanced modules for major failure modes compatible with CMS and tested in a relevant environment
– Novel algorithms for rolling contact fatigue and structural health
– Enhanced diagnostics and prognostic modules: Fatigue and wear of raceways detection and loss of structural integrity detection
